The Qualities Of A Good Fire Truck Mechanic Ohio

By Della Monroe


It is important to keep fire trucks in good operating condition. This can be achieved by using the services of competent mechanics. One of the biggest issues that fire departments have is finding competent mechanics to repair firefighting apparatus. In order to find a competent fire truck mechanic Ohio residents should consider a few factors.

One of the important factors to consider is certification. Many reputable mechanics have the Emergency Vehicle Technician or Automotive Service Excellence certification. These certifications are an indication that mechanics have completed the necessary training and have experience in servicing and repairing emergency vehicles. By hiring a certified mechanic, you can be sure that you will receive high quality services.

Another thing to consider is accreditation. Technicians who are acknowledged by accrediting bodies have noteworthy expertise in fire truck maintenance and repair. In order to meet the level of attainment required by accrediting bodies, mechanics must posses the right knowledge and equipment.

Considering if a fire truck mechanic has a good reputation is also essential. You can ask the technician to provide you with references from former clients. You can also read customer reviews to know if the technician offers satisfactory services. Another option is to get recommendations from associates. You can also consult consumer organizations like the local chamber of commerce and the Better Business Bureau to get information about an emergency vehicle repair shop. Find out if any complaints have been filed against it and if they were resolved.

Another sign that fire truck mechanic is skilled and knowledgeable is experience. You can ask the mechanics you speak with about the number years they have repaired firefighting trucks. An experienced technician can provide superior quality services than one who is inexperienced.

When speaking to mechanics, you should also ask them about the fees they charge for particular jobs. You can ask several mechanics to provide you with quotes. In this way, you will be able to know who charges reasonable fees. Most professionally run fire truck repair shops display their rates for diagnostic work and labor in the front office. You can negotiate the charges professionally.

A good repair shop will also have helpful and courteous staff. The manager or technicians should be willing to answer your questions satisfactorily. You should also find out if the facility performs the type of repairs you need. Some facilities specialize while others offer many different kinds of repairs. A good emergency vehicle repair facility will also be well organized, tidy and have modern equipment in the service bays.

It is also essential to consider if a fire truck mechanic has liability insurance. If the technician is insured, you will not be liable for paying medical bills if he or she gets injured while working on the truck. Considering the warranty offered by a technician is also essential. A warranty gives you the right to request a full service for the same job within a period of two months or more without spending extra money. By hiring a competent mechanic, you can get the best outcome.
